I often stop somewhere for a protein fill after the gym and went here one saturday to fill my craving. The staff are so friendly and happy its enough to make your day.I got the wrap.The meat was lovely but the stuffing was a bit to herby for me It took over a little.I had never though of putting coleslaw with pulled pork but it really works.I felt the portion was a little small for the money when compared to oink and Jones & sons (they have a stall outside John Lewis on a Saturday)Id definitely go back again it i needed a protein fix fast.See my august blog post titled : August Titbits thehobson.co.uk
How much is that piggy in the window?As it turns out buying the whole pig is fairly expensive, but a roll or wrap is reasonably priced and terrifically tasty.This slow cooked hog is succulent, portable and comes with cracking crackling.For those with a sense of adventure you can add your own sauces, obviously we recommend the chilli sauce for even more excitement.Weve had our fair share of pulled pork in Edinburgh and so far this is reigning champion. edinbraw.com
